    Two women reported stolen wallets while at Upper West Side movie theaters. A 65-year-old woman from Midtown West had her wallet stolen at Lincoln Plaza Theater on 1886 Broadway and West 62nd Street. She told police that she was in a crowded theater at 7 p.m. When she got home, the wallet, containing credit cards and $37 in cash, was missing. The credit cards were unused. A 36-year-old woman from Kentucky staying at an Upper West Side apartment reported her wallet was stolen at a Loew?s cinema on 1998 Broadway and West 68th Street Nov. 11. She told police she was watching a movie and put her purse and jacket in the empty seat next to her. During the movie, a man sat in a vacant seat next to her items and left before the end. She realized her wallet was gone at 6:45 p.m. when she noticed her bag felt light. The movie burglar got $40 in cash and credit cards that were not used before they were canceled.
